إنشاء مشاريع بايثون صغيرة بطرق مبتكرة ومتقدمة
تعتبر “مشاريع بايثون صغيرة” فرصة رائعة لتعلم البرمجة وتطبيق المهارات المكتسبة بطريقة عملية وممتعة. سواء كنت مبتدئًا أو لديك خبرة سابقة، فإن إنشاء هذه المشاريع يساعدك على فهم المفاهيم الأساسية وتعزيز مهاراتك في البرمجة. تستخدم بايثون في العديد من المجالات، مثل تطوير الويب وعلوم البيانات وتطبيقات الذكاء الاصطناعي، مما يجعلها لغة برمجة شائعة. في هذه المقالة، سنستعرض مجموعة من الطرق لإنشاء مشاريع بايثون صغيرة بطرق مبتكرة ومتقدمة، مما يساعد في تحسين مهارات البرمجة لديك.
ما هي هذه الخدمة ولماذا هي مهمة؟
تمثل “مشاريع بايثون صغيرة” أحد أسس تعلم البرمجة عبر لغة بايثون. هذه المشاريع تتيح للمستخدمين فرصة التطبيق العملي للمعرفة النظرية التي اكتسبوها من خلال الدورات التعليمية أو الكتب. في ظل التطور السريع في مجالات التكنولوجيا والبرمجة، تبرز أهمية هذه المشاريع بشكل خاص. فهي توفر لك طريقة رائعة لإظهار المهارات التي تعلمتها. بالإضافة إلى ذلك، تقوم المشاريع الصغيرة بتعزيز التفكير الإبداعي وتطوير مهارات حل المشكلات. عبر تنفيذ هذه المشاريع، يمكنك تجربة الأساليب الحديثة في تطوير البرمجيات وتحليل البيانات.
عند العمل على مشروع بايثون، يمكنك أن تستفيد من العديد من المكتبات المساعدة مثل NumPy وPandas لتحليل البيانات، أو Flask وDjango لتطوير تطبيقات الويب. هذه المكتبات تعزز من مهاراتك التقنية وتفتح لك مجالات جديدة للإبداع. علاوة على ذلك، يتمتع العديد من أصحاب العمل بميزة المرونة في الاختيار، حيث يفضلون المتقدمين الذين يمتلكون خبرات عملية في مجالات برمجية معينة، وهذا ما توفره لك المشاريع الصغيرة.
الميزات الرئيسية والمكونات الأساسية للخدمة
عند التفكير في “مشاريع بايثون صغيرة”، من المهم فهم الميزات الرئيسية والمكونات الأساسية التي تجعلها فعالة. أولاً، يجب أن يحتوي المشروع على تطبيق عملي لمفهوم برمجي معين. مثلاً، يمكنك تصميم مشروع بسيط لتحليل بيانات معينة باستخدام مكتبة بايثون مثل Pandas. هذا سيمكنك من تطبيق المفاهييم المفيدة في البيئات العملية.
علاوة على ذلك، يفضل أن يتضمن المشروع رسومات بيانية أو واجهات مستخدم. استخدام مكتبة Matplotlib أو Tkinter يعتبر خطوة ممتازة لتحسين المشاريع. كما أن التكامل مع APIs يُعد من المكونات الأساسية أيضًا، مثل استخدام API لعرض بيانات الطقس أو البيانات المالية في المشروع.
من المهم أيضًا أن تتعلم كيفية توثيق مشروعك. توثيق الكود بشكل جيد يسهل على الآخرين فهم المشروع واستخدامه. بالإضافة إلى ذلك، يمكنك نشر مشاريعك على منصات مثل GitHub، مما يتيح لك بناء محفظة عمل قوية تجذب أصحاب العمل. بفضل هذه الميزات، ستتمكن من تطوير مشاريع تزيد من فرصك في دخول سوق العمل.
من يمكنه الاستفادة وسيناريوهات التنفيذ العملي
تستهدف “مشاريع بايثون صغيرة” مجموعة متنوعة من المهتمين، بدءًا من الطلاب الجدد في مجال البرمجة وصولًا إلى المطورين المحترفين الذين يبحثون عن تطوير مهاراتهم. بالنسبة للطلاب، تعتبر هذه المشاريع نقطة انطلاق لفهم كيفية تطبيق البرمجة في مجالات مختلفة. من ناحية أخرى، يمكن للمحترفين استخدام هذه المشاريع لتوسيع مهاراتهم وإضافة قيمة إلى سيرتهم الذاتية.
يمكنك تنفيذ مشاريع بايثون في عدة سيناريوهات. على سبيل المثال، إذا كنت مهتمًا بتحليل البيانات، يمكنك تجربة مشروع بسيط لتحليل بيانات مستمدة من الإنترنت أو مصدر محلي وإنشاء تقارير مرئية منها. أما إذا كنت تفضل تطوير تطبيقات الويب، يمكنك إنشاء موقع بسيط لإدارة المهام باستخدام Flask، مما يعرض مهاراتك في تنظيم البيانات وتطوير تجربة صارف مميزة.
أيضًا، يمكنك توسيع مشاريعك بإضافة مكونات جديدة مثال: استخدام تعلم الآلة لتقديم تنبؤات في تطبيقات معينة، مما يجعل المشروع أكثر تعقيدًا ويعزز من فهمك للذكاء الاصطناعي. بالتالي، مع كل مشروع، تتوسع مهاراتك وتصبح قادرًا على التعامل مع تحديات البرمجة المتقدمة.
في الختام، تعتبر “مشاريع بايثون صغيرة” فرصة مثالية لتطبيق المعرفة وتحسين المهارات البرمجية. من خلال هذه المشاريع، يمكنك تعزيز خبرتك في تطوير البرمجيات وتحليل البيانات. بالإضافة إلى ذلك، ستتمكن من خلق نماذج فعلية تعكس إبداعك ومهاراتك الفنية في هذا المجال.
لطلب خدمة “إنشاء مشاريع بايثون صغيرة بطرق مبتكرة ومتقدمة”، تواصل معنا عبر واتساب:
الرقم الأول | الرقم الثاني
